Got a spare $1.8 million? Institutions that don’t have adequate cybersecurity protections may need that much or more to clean up after a cyberattack.
A report on 2018 cybersecurity incidents from the Identity Theft Resource Center and Generali Global Assistance pegs the average cost of a cybersecurity attack on a financial institution at $1.8 million – and that’s only the up-front cost.
